Sajó-Rima

Sajó-Rima EGTC is located in the catchment area of the Sajó and Rima rivers, and brings together the municipalities of the region. The official registration date of the grouping was 3 April 2013. The members of the grouping are Putnok and Ózd on the Hungarian side and Rimavská Sobota and Tornal'a on the Slovakian side. The territory of the EGTC's four members contains 193 settlements, 66 on the Hungarian side and 127 on the Slovakian side.

The general objective of the grouping is to strengthen economic and social cohesion between its members through cross-border cooperation financed by both countries. The specific goals of the grouping are to prepare and implement joint programmes for economic development, agriculture, industry, trade, services, and tourism.

 Seat: Putnok (HUNGARY)

Date of constitution: 03/04/2013 (Registration)

Number in CoR Register: 42

Director: Kacsik PËTER

Members in Hungary: Putnok Város Önkormányzata, Ózd Város Önkormányzata

Member in Slovakia: Rimavská Sobota, Tornaľa
